OPEN-SOURCE SCRIPT
Neeson RSI Pro Ultra

NEESON RSI PRO ULTRA
📊 Overview
The Neeson RSI Pro Ultra is an advanced Relative Strength Index indicator that combines traditional RSI analysis with modern technical innovations. It features dynamic volatility-adjusted bands, smart divergence detection, and multi-theme visualization.
🎯 Key Features
1. Dynamic Volatility Bands
Automatically adjusts overbought/oversold levels based on market volatility
Upper Band: 70 ± (Volatility × Multiplier)
Lower Band: 30 ± (Volatility × Multiplier)
Prevents false signals in high-volatility markets
2. Advanced Divergence Detection
Regular Divergence: Price makes higher highs while RSI makes lower highs (bearish), or price makes lower lows while RSI makes higher lows (bullish)
Hidden Divergence: Price makes lower highs while RSI makes higher highs (bearish), or price makes higher lows while RSI makes lower lows (bullish)
Visual background highlighting for divergence areas
3. Smart Trading Signals
Buy Signal: RSI crosses above dynamic lower band
Sell Signal: RSI crosses below dynamic upper band
Strong Buy/Sell: Signal confirmed by divergence patterns
Clear label markers on chart
4. Customizable Visualization
Multiple color themes (Orange White Blue, Professional Blue, Vibrant Orange)
Custom color options for all elements
Cloud zones for overbought/oversold areas
Optional signal display
⚙️ Parameter Settings
Basic Parameters
RSI Length: Period for RSI calculation (default: 14)
Use RSI Smoothing: Applies EMA smoothing to RSI line
Dynamic Bands
Volatility Period: Lookback period for volatility calculation (default: 20)
Volatility Multiplier: Sensitivity of band adjustment (default: 1.5)
Enable Dynamic Levels: Toggle dynamic band adjustment
Divergence Detection
Divergence Lookback Period: Bars to search for divergence (default: 90)
Show Regular Divergence: Display regular divergence patterns
Show Hidden Divergence: Display hidden divergence patterns
Display Options
Show Cloud Zones: Display overbought/oversold cloud areas
Show Trading Signals: Display buy/sell signal labels
📈 Interpretation Guide
Overbought/Oversold Conditions
Overbought: RSI above dynamic upper band (colored background)
Oversold: RSI below dynamic lower band (colored background)
Neutral: RSI between bands (white background)
Signal Types
BUY/SELL: Basic crossover signals
STRONG BUY/STRONG SELL: Signals confirmed by divergence
BEAR DIV/BULL DIV: Divergence detection markers
Divergence Types
Regular Bearish: Price ↑, RSI ↓ (Red background)
Regular Bullish: Price ↓, RSI ↑ (Green background)
Hidden Bearish: Price ↓, RSI ↑ (Light red background)
Hidden Bullish: Price ↑, RSI ↓ (Light green background)
📊 Overview
The Neeson RSI Pro Ultra is an advanced Relative Strength Index indicator that combines traditional RSI analysis with modern technical innovations. It features dynamic volatility-adjusted bands, smart divergence detection, and multi-theme visualization.
🎯 Key Features
1. Dynamic Volatility Bands
Automatically adjusts overbought/oversold levels based on market volatility
Upper Band: 70 ± (Volatility × Multiplier)
Lower Band: 30 ± (Volatility × Multiplier)
Prevents false signals in high-volatility markets
2. Advanced Divergence Detection
Regular Divergence: Price makes higher highs while RSI makes lower highs (bearish), or price makes lower lows while RSI makes higher lows (bullish)
Hidden Divergence: Price makes lower highs while RSI makes higher highs (bearish), or price makes higher lows while RSI makes lower lows (bullish)
Visual background highlighting for divergence areas
3. Smart Trading Signals
Buy Signal: RSI crosses above dynamic lower band
Sell Signal: RSI crosses below dynamic upper band
Strong Buy/Sell: Signal confirmed by divergence patterns
Clear label markers on chart
4. Customizable Visualization
Multiple color themes (Orange White Blue, Professional Blue, Vibrant Orange)
Custom color options for all elements
Cloud zones for overbought/oversold areas
Optional signal display
⚙️ Parameter Settings
Basic Parameters
RSI Length: Period for RSI calculation (default: 14)
Use RSI Smoothing: Applies EMA smoothing to RSI line
Dynamic Bands
Volatility Period: Lookback period for volatility calculation (default: 20)
Volatility Multiplier: Sensitivity of band adjustment (default: 1.5)
Enable Dynamic Levels: Toggle dynamic band adjustment
Divergence Detection
Divergence Lookback Period: Bars to search for divergence (default: 90)
Show Regular Divergence: Display regular divergence patterns
Show Hidden Divergence: Display hidden divergence patterns
Display Options
Show Cloud Zones: Display overbought/oversold cloud areas
Show Trading Signals: Display buy/sell signal labels
📈 Interpretation Guide
Overbought/Oversold Conditions
Overbought: RSI above dynamic upper band (colored background)
Oversold: RSI below dynamic lower band (colored background)
Neutral: RSI between bands (white background)
Signal Types
BUY/SELL: Basic crossover signals
STRONG BUY/STRONG SELL: Signals confirmed by divergence
BEAR DIV/BULL DIV: Divergence detection markers
Divergence Types
Regular Bearish: Price ↑, RSI ↓ (Red background)
Regular Bullish: Price ↓, RSI ↑ (Green background)
Hidden Bearish: Price ↓, RSI ↑ (Light red background)
Hidden Bullish: Price ↑, RSI ↓ (Light green background)
Script de código aberto
No verdadeiro espirito do TradingView, o autor desse script o publicou como código aberto, para que os traders possam entendê-lo e verificá-lo. Parabéns ao autor Você pode usá-lo gratuitamente, mas a reutilização desse código em publicações e regida pelas Regras da Casa.
Aviso legal
As informações e publicações não devem ser e não constituem conselhos ou recomendações financeiras, de investimento, de negociação ou de qualquer outro tipo, fornecidas ou endossadas pela TradingView. Leia mais em Termos de uso.
Script de código aberto
No verdadeiro espirito do TradingView, o autor desse script o publicou como código aberto, para que os traders possam entendê-lo e verificá-lo. Parabéns ao autor Você pode usá-lo gratuitamente, mas a reutilização desse código em publicações e regida pelas Regras da Casa.
Aviso legal
As informações e publicações não devem ser e não constituem conselhos ou recomendações financeiras, de investimento, de negociação ou de qualquer outro tipo, fornecidas ou endossadas pela TradingView. Leia mais em Termos de uso.